Central Auditory Processing Disorders Associated With Blast Exposure
NCT00554801 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 84
Last updated 2018-08-10
Summary
The incidence of central auditory dysfunction in war fighters who are exposed to high-explosive blasts while serving in combat have not been clearly determined. The objectives of this study are to determine whether central auditory processing (CAP) disorders are associated with exposure to high-explosive blasts. This study will also examine the incidence, magnitude and timing of spontaneous recovery of CAP function from blast exposure. The information provided by this study will help guide clinicians in both the military and VA health care systems regarding the likelihood of central auditory processing disorders in soldiers returning from deployment and suggest some clinical rehabilitative strategies for the treatment of these patients with CAP deficits.

Audiological testing
Subjects will take part in a battery of audiological tests meant to evaluate the function and status of the auditory system. These tests are similar to the kinds of testing carried out routinely in audiology clinics, and include behavioral tests of pure tone hearing, speech perception, and central auditory function, and electrophysiological testing of the middle ear and of the central auditory system.
